Its that time of the year again!
We are holding the 2nd Annual beachvolleyball tournament in the valley. This year all proceeds will go towards the Daylen Ostapowich charity fund. There will be a few slight changes.


1) It will be taking place at new castle beach since we no longer have a set beach court
2)ALL proceeds will be going towards the above charity
3)Only the winner of the tournament will be awarded with a prize
4)Two courts will be set up to allow more playing time and less waiting around

Other details:
-4 on 4 tournament
-Food and drinks will be avalible for purchase
-25$ team entry fee(to be paid before first match)
-Each team member will be provided with 1 free hot dog/burger and 1 drink

A LITTLE BACK GROUND INFORMATION:

Daylen was diagnosed at the age of 4 and now 3 years later they are still coping with what this disease has thrown at thhem. Heavy medications which suppress his immune system which makes the common a cold a possible hopsitalization, they also carry significant side effects like cancer and high blood pressure. He goes through constant blood monitoring through needles at the hospital on a monthly basis, several doctors visits, diet control and kidney biopsy's which they are planning for again in the near future. He also has and does take high doses of steroids to stop his relapses and those have taken a hard hit to his bones. From repeated use, he has gone from normal to the bottom end of normal as far as bone density. Osteoporosis is also something they are keeping an eye on. Something as simple as a common cold or a bug bite send his immune system reeling and his kidneys just don't function properly and he becomes "nephrotic".
